#include<cstdio>
#include<algorithm>
using namespace std;
int main(){
bool flag=1;
int mzcd[105]={0},mzhcd[105]={0},n;
scanf("%d",&n);
for(int i=0;i<n;i++)scanf("%d",&mzcd[i]);
for(int i=0;i<n;i++)scanf("%d",&mzhcd[i]);
sort(mzcd,mzcd+n-1);
sort(mzhcd,mzhcd+n-1);
for(int i=0;i<n;i++){
if(mzcd[i]>mzhcd[i]){
flag=0;
printf("%s","NE");
break;
}
}
if(flag)printf("%s","DA");
return 0;
}
亲测是因为sort没起作用,但不知道原因,dalao们帮忙看一下哪里有问题好吗?